Starting Point at Piazza Dante
Your journey begins in Piazza Dante, a central hub in Naples brimming with history and life. Standing in front of Dante’s statue, you’ll meet your guide, Miriam, whose passion for her city shines through. She’s not just a guide but a local artist and cook, ready to share her deep knowledge of Naples’ streets, food, and art.
First Food Tasting (15 Minutes)
Soon after, you’ll dive into your first tasting—probably a typical Neapolitan coffee or a pastry like sfogliatella. These initial bites set the tone for the meal-focused adventure, giving you an immediate taste of Naples’ legendary culinary scene. Miriam’s stories about each dish add a layer of context, making each tasting more meaningful.
Walking Tour to Market and Spaccanapoli (10 Minutes & 15 Minutes)
Next, the tour involves a walk across the historic center, moving toward the traditional market and Spaccanapoli—the narrow, bustling street that slices through Naples’ core. During this segment, Miriam shares insights about the city’s architecture and street art, which adorn many buildings along the route, offering visual stories to complement your tasting experience.

Spaccanapoli Food Tasting (1 Hour)
The heart of the tour is a comprehensive food tasting in Spaccanapoli, lasting an hour. This stretch includes sampling mozzarella, taralli, chocolata foresta (a traditional chocolate treat), and fried pizza—each bite telling a story of Naples’ culinary heritage. Reviewers mention the guide’s storytelling, which makes the tastings feel like a personal journey through Naples’ culinary soul.
Via dei Tribunali Walk and Tastings (20 Minutes)
Moving to Via dei Tribunali, known for its historic pizzerias and local eateries, you’ll continue your exploration on foot. The walk provides a chance to observe the lively street life and architecture, with Miriam pointing out hidden details and street art that often go unnoticed.
Via San Gregorio Armeno (20 Minutes)
Your final tasting happens in Via San Gregorio Armeno, famous for its artisan nativity scene figures and festive crafts. Here, you’ll enjoy more local flavors, possibly including a sweet or specialty from artisans’ shops. Reviewers have highlighted this as a favorite part, noting the charming atmosphere and the chance to buy unique souvenirs.
